- The distance between Paulistana, Brazil and Miliana, Algeria is approximately 6,699 km or 4,163 mi.
- To reach Paulistana in this distance one would set out from Miliana bearing 231.5° or SW and follow the great circles arc to approach Paulistana bearing 219.6° or SW .
- Paulistana has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h) whereas Miliana has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Both are in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 10 °C (18°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.9 °C (25°F) less in Paulistana.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 230 mm (9.1 in) less which is equivalent to 230 l/m² (5.64 US gal/ft²) or 2,300,000 l/ha (245,885 US gal/ac) less. About 5/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 19.7° higher in Paulistana than in Miliana.
